Establishing a Fitness Routine That Works for You

Establishing a sustainable fitness routine is key to overall wellness. Start by choosing physical activities you genuinely enjoy, whether it’s yoga, running, swimming or strength training. The options are endless, so try different classes or activities to find what motivates you.

Once you’ve found your groove, pencil in time for exercise 3-4 times per week. Even just 30 minutes a day a few times a week can have significant benefits. If your schedule is tight, break it up into two 15-minute sessions. The most important thing is making fitness a priority and part of your regular routine.

Don’t get discouraged if you miss a day or week. Simply get back to your routine and build from there.

Start slow and listen to your body. Increase intensity and weights over time as your endurance improves.

Staying consistent but avoiding burnout is key.

Strength training with weights, resistance bands or bodyweight exercises 2-3 times a week is ideal for building muscle and bone density. But if weights aren’t your thing, try yoga, Tai Chi or pilates which provide strength and flexibility benefits using your own body weight.

Getting outside for walks, jogs or hikes is also a great option if weather permits. Sunshine and fresh air provide vitamin D and mood benefits in addition to exercise. Invite a friend for accountability and motivation.

Practicing Mindfulness and Meditation

Practicing mindfulness and meditation is one of the best ways to improve your wellbeing. Taking time each day to quiet your mind and focus your awareness has significant benefits for both your physical and mental health.

Reduce Stress

Chronic stress can negatively impact your health and quality of life. Meditation helps decrease stress hormones like cortisol while increasing feel-good hormones like dopamine. Even just a few minutes a day of deep breathing, mindfulness meditation or yoga can help you better manage stressful situations and reduce anxiety.

Improve Concentration

Regular meditation strengthens the connections between brain cells, enhancing your ability to focus and pay attention. Studies show meditation can lead to changes in gray matter density and neural connectivity in areas involved in learning, memory, sense of self, and stress regulation. With practice, you may find it easier to concentrate and avoid distractions.

Sleep Better

Meditation relaxes the body and mind, making it easier to fall asleep and stay asleep. Research shows meditating before bed leads to decreased insomnia, less waking during the night and overall improved sleep quality. The relaxation and awareness meditation fosters also helps release any tensions or worries that could keep you up at night.

Setting Aside Time for Self-Care

Making time for yourself is one of the most important things you can do for your wellbeing. Setting aside time each day for self-care will help reduce stress and boost your physical and mental health.

Exercise

Whether it’s a 30-minute walk or an intense HIIT workout, aim for at least 20-30 minutes of exercise most days. Exercise releases endorphins that improve your mood and act as natural stress relievers. It also helps you sleep better at night, which leads to greater wellness during the day.

Yoga and meditation

Practicing yoga or meditation is a great way to unwind and de-stress. Spending just 5-10 minutes a day focusing your breathing can help increase mindfulness and decrease anxiety. Yoga also provides physical benefits like increased flexibility and core strength.

Limit screen time

Too much screen time, especially before bed, disrupts your circadian rhythm and makes it harder to fall asleep. Put away your devices an hour before bed and do something relaxing like reading a book, taking a warm bath or listening to calming music.

Connecting with others

Call a friend or family member, meet for coffee or simply engage in meaningful conversations with people in your life. Social interaction and support from others have been shown to boost longevity and life satisfaction.

Building a Supportive Community of Women

Building a network of like-minded women can make a big difference in your wellness journey. Surround yourself with a community that will support your goals and hold you accountable. Some ways to find your tribe:

Join an online community.

Search for Facebook groups or use apps like Meetup to find local women’s wellness groups. Introduce yourself, share your goals, and look for workout buddies or an accountability partner. Having a strong virtual support system will keep you motivated even when life gets busy.

Take a class at your local gym or community center.

Yoga, spin class, martial arts—whatever interests you. Not only will you get the benefits of the activity itself, but you’ll bond with others in the class over your shared experience. Exchange numbers with a few classmates and suggest meeting up to walk or grab coffee. New friendships can blossom when you see familiar faces week after week.

Volunteer for a good cause.

Find an organisation in your area that promotes women’s health and wellness. Assisting with events, outreach, or other tasks is a great way to do good for others while also expanding your circle of connections. The women you meet while volunteering will likely share your passion for wellness and self-care.
